Block

#23,096,570
Block Number
23,096,570 @ 10/26/2025, 16:31:50
Status
Finalized
ID
0x01606cfa8a867b520f92b6323073405f7c7a1ba7c8f313e0b55497ad6a562e88
Transactions
Gas Used
6462206/40000000 (16.16% Used)
Base Fee
10,000 Gwei
Total Score
2,256,475,568 (+101)
Rewards
3.26 VTHO